MISSION: San Diego Habitat for Humanity brings people together to build homes, communities, and hope. Habitat was founded on the conviction that every man, woman and child should have a simple, decent and affordable home to live in dignity and safety.
San Diego Habitat builds housing for affordable homeownership and works with communities to revitalize neighborhoods and build and repair houses throughout San Diego County supported
by fundraising, in-kind materials, corporate partnerships and volunteer labor.
